Jammu, April 30 -- Legendary Pakistani cricketer Wasim Akram, who was diagnosed with diabetes over 15 years ago, recently took to social media to give fans a glimpse into his typical morning routine for managing his condition. According to Akram's post, he wakes up at 6:30 AM and immediately administers six units of insulin to regulate his blood sugar levels.

After his insulin dose, Akram enjoys a cup of coffee to help start his day. He then heads out for an intense 10.5 km walk to get his body moving and burn some calories. Upon returning home around 10 AM, it is finally time for breakfast. Akram's wife has prepared him a nutrient-dense yogurt parfait filled with bananas, berries, nuts, seeds and muesli for sustained energy.
